“暴力计算”模式触及极限,算力进入系统工程时代
Mei Ri Jing Ji Xin Wen· 2025-12-22 12:12
Core Insights - The computing power industry is undergoing a significant shift from a focus on single-point performance to system efficiency and multi-party collaboration in response to the demands of large models [1][2][3] Group 1: Industry Trends - The consensus among industry leaders is that the competition in computing power has evolved, necessitating a shift from a full-stack approach to a collaborative system engineering model [1][2] - As the scale of models increases to trillions of parameters, the challenges faced by computing systems extend beyond peak computing power to include interconnect bandwidth, storage hierarchy, power cooling, and system stability [2][3] - Traditional computing nodes are becoming inadequate for supporting large-scale models, leading to a consensus shift towards super-node and super-cluster models that utilize high-speed buses to connect multiple GPUs [3] Group 2: Challenges in the Ecosystem - The full-stack self-research model adopted by many domestic manufacturers has led to increased internal competition and fragmentation, creating multiple closed ecosystems that complicate user experiences [4][5] - Users face significant challenges in adapting to various chip architectures, leading to high costs and reduced development efficiency due to the need for extensive optimization and adaptation [5][6] - The lack of a cohesive ecosystem in domestic AI development is seen as a bottleneck, with manufacturers struggling to achieve seamless integration between hardware and software [6] Group 3: Shift to Open Computing - Open computing is being emphasized as a necessary approach, requiring manufacturers to move away from a "one company does it all" mentality towards a collaborative model where multiple firms contribute to different layers of the system [7][8] - The transition to open computing involves significant challenges, including the need to relinquish some control and profit margins, as well as establishing effective coordination mechanisms among various stakeholders [7][8] - A layered decoupling of the industry chain is essential for open computing, where different companies work on components like chips, interconnects, and storage while maintaining unified standards to ensure system efficiency [8] Group 4: Future Outlook - The coexistence of tightly coupled closed systems and open collaborative systems is expected to persist in the rich application landscape of the domestic market [9] - The ability to create an efficient, collaborative, and sustainably evolving system will be a critical factor determining the survival of manufacturers in the evolving landscape of large models and super clusters [9]

北京发布升级版“系统软件栈”,支持全球20多款主流AI芯片
Xin Jing Bao· 2025-09-26 09:51
Core Insights - The 2025 Artificial Intelligence Computing Conference was held in Beijing, where the upgraded "system software stack" called "Zhongzhi FlagOS" v1.5 was released, marking a new phase in the global AI underlying technology ecosystem focused on "open computing" [1] - The development of large AI models requires significant computing power, and the differences in software ecosystems and interfaces among various chips complicate model migration and adaptation, limiting the application of diverse computing resources [1] Group 1 - The "Zhongzhi FlagOS" aims to provide unified, open, and efficient computing support for AI models, addressing compatibility issues among different AI chips [1] - The system software layer enhances computing resource utilization, simplifies model migration, and supports multiple intelligent application scenarios, becoming a critical infrastructure for supporting large models in the scale of billions [1] - The "Zhongzhi FlagOS" v1.5 has achieved breakthroughs in four dimensions: comprehensiveness, automation, performance, and application scenarios [2] Group 2 - The upgraded system fully supports the development and deployment of robot "brain" and "small brain" models, providing robust system support for smarter robots [2] - Improvements in parallel strategies and scheduling algorithms have led to a maximum training acceleration of 36.8% and a 20% acceleration in inference for typical large model tasks [2] - The "Zhongzhi FlagOS" v1.5 supports over 20 mainstream AI chips globally, and the general operator library FlagGems has become the largest Triton language operator library, with over 200 core operators [2] Group 3 - To promote AI system technology talent cultivation, the Beijing Academy of Artificial Intelligence has launched the "Zhongzhi FlagOS" university program in collaboration with over 10 universities, including Peking University and Tsinghua University [3] - The "Super Node Intelligent Computing Application 'Beijing Plan'" was officially released, focusing on creating an inclusive AI computing foundation for various scenarios such as embodied intelligence, intelligent manufacturing, and smart healthcare [3] - The Beijing Artificial Intelligence Standardization Technical Committee was established, along with the "Beijing Reconfigurable Computing Soft and Hardware Collaborative Technology Innovation Center" [3]
2025开放计算技术大会举行,加速AIDC全球协作
Zhong Guo Xin Wen Wang· 2025-08-11 11:03
Group 1 - The 2025 Open Computing Technology Conference focuses on the development trends of MoE (Mixture of Experts) large models and AI agents, emphasizing the importance of open computing for enhancing vertical scaling and horizontal efficiency [1] - The rise of open-source models and open computing systems is becoming a mainstream trend in the AI era, facilitating global collaboration and addressing the challenges faced by future GW-level AI data centers [1][2] - The conference is co-hosted by the Open Compute Project (OCP) and the Open Computing Technical Committee (OCTC), with participation from over a thousand experts and representatives from major companies and institutions [1] Group 2 - The combination of open-source models and open computing is expected to drive a surge in long-tail applications, accelerating the realization of AI accessibility [2] - OCP's focus is shifting towards AI, with strategic plans centered around open systems for AI, including physical and IT infrastructure for data centers [2] - The OCTC emphasizes the need for industry collaboration and the establishment of practical standards to promote technological innovation and benefits across various sectors [2] Group 3 - The rapid growth of MoE model parameters is driving a transformation in computing architecture, necessitating extreme requirements for computing density and interconnect speed [3] - The industry is moving towards a new era characterized by super-node architectures that optimize network, computing, software, and hardware [3] - Challenges such as power, interconnect, and reliability in AI infrastructure are prompting a reconfiguration of computing systems, with super-node architecture becoming a core development path [3] Group 4 - The core goal of the open computing community is to leverage ecosystem strengths to break performance bottlenecks and drive business innovation [4] - The GW-level AI data centers are catalyzing significant changes in the computing ecosystem, accelerating cross-community collaboration [5] - OCP is preparing to establish the "GW-level Open Intelligent Computing Center OCP China Community Group" to promote the implementation of AI open systems in China [5]
